    Ministry Operations Coordinator Pleasant Valley Baptist Church • Liberty, MO Full-Time

    Pleasant Valley Baptist Church is seeking a Ministry Operations Coordinator who brings clarity, reliability, and strong follow-through to the daily work of Care Ministries. The role supports the Pastor of Care Ministries and its ministry partners by keeping established processes organized, timely, and accurate. Someone who takes ownership, values excellence, and enjoys ensuring details are handled the right way. This position requires membership at Pleasant Valley Baptist Church.

    Responsibilities

    Operations
    

    Maintain the accuracy of our ministry database, Planning Center Online. Input and manage workflows, attendee communication, class/group attendance, reporting information consistently and providing reliable data for ministry decision-making.

    Safeguard the ministry by ensuring adherence to ministry and church policies, including liability waivers for care assistance and the Cars Ministry, including facility usage protocols. You serve as a firm but kind guardrail, helping volunteers remain compliant with established safety and liability standards.

    Serve as the primary point of contact for general Care Ministries inquiries. Professionally route sensitive and confidential requests to the appropriate ministry, ensuring individuals are connected to the right support system without personally managing their care.

    Ministry Partner Support

    Serve as the logistical hub by facilitating operational tasks to support the leaders of Care’s four core areas: Financial Care, Care Classes, Support Groups, and the Cars Ministry.

    Manage the administrative timeline for semester-based classes/groups. Execute the administrative framework—building registrations in Planning Center (PCO), ordering curriculum, and ensuring facilities are prepared for weekly meetings.care.

    Financial

    Act as the first step in our financial assistance process. Receive incoming requests and vet them against established criteria and process to ensure strategic alignment. Prepare the necessary background information for informed decision making by the Pastor of Care Ministries and the Financial Care Team on where resources are best applied.

    Facilitate the stewardship of the benevolence funds in partnership with the Financial Care Team and the Accounting Dept. by preparing the requests for review and ensure all approved transactions have the precise documentation and approvals required to process and fully document the payment.

    Track budget line items for the pastor and ministry partners and provide regular spending updates by helping the team maintain visibility on resources to ensure healthy stewardship.

    Complete expense reports, purchase requisitions, check requests, invoice reconciliation for cars ministry, counseling requests, scholarship tracking and accounting.

    Qualifications

    Professional Competencies

    Willing to uphold policy and criteria even when it is uncomfortable. Values fairness and process over making exceptions.

    Ability to analyze a problem and present a solution. Thrives in an environment where the supervisor is often inaccessible due to other leadership duties.

    High comfort level with accounting; invoices, general ledger codes, and budget tracking.

    Competent in Google Workspace, Excel, and database management (Planning Center Online).

    Spiritual & Cultural Fit

    Able to work in a heavy care environment (grief, trauma) without becoming emotionally enmeshed. Measures success by completing the task until the end.

    View administrative precision (accuracy, timeliness, stewardship) as your primary spiritual act of service.

    A personal and growing relationship with Jesus Christ.

    Education & Experience

    High School diploma required; Bachelor’s degree in Business, Administration, or related field preferred.

    5+ years of administrative experience, specifically dealing with finance, logistics, or project coordination.

    Military or Executive Assistant background is a plus.
